The Consumer Lender is responsible for developing, originating, underwriting, and managing consumer loan relationships while providing exceptional customer service. This position serves as a trusted financial advisor by identifying customer needs, recommending appropriate lending solutions, and strengthening customer relationships through cross-selling PrimeSouth Bank products and services. The Consumer Lender is expected to maintain a quality loan portfolio while meeting established production and portfolio management goals.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
Lending & Portfolio Management
- Develop new consumer lending relationships through referrals, networking, and community involvement.
- Interview loan applicants and analyze financial information to determine creditworthiness.
- Structure, underwrite, and originate consumer loans in accordance with bank policy and regulatory requirements.
- Present loan recommendations for approval within delegated authority.
- Ensure loan files are complete, accurate, and properly documented.
- Monitor and manage an assigned loan portfolio, including renewals and periodic reviews.
- Identify and proactively address delinquency or credit concerns.
